The flowering Dogwood is a native American tree, growing from Massachusetts to northern Florida and west into Texas. The genus name comes from the Latin word for horn, cornu, most likely in reference to the tree's hard, dense wood. Large, white flower bracts appear in early spring while emerging foliage displays shades of bronzy-green or yellow-green. Flower buds are round and flattened at the ends of stems, (many) greenish-yellow; bud is biscuit-shaped, glabrous and flattened, gray-green, at branch ends, covered by 2 large silky scales becoming 2 of the showy white bracts. Connecticut Cornus florida, commonly known as flowering dogwood, is a small deciduous tree that typically grows 15-30' tall with a low-branching, broadly-pyramidal but somewhat flat-topped habit.It arguably may be the most beautiful of the native American flowering trees.
